This is a scene from the Battle of Mygeeto in Battlefront 2. It is from the part on the bridge with the two holes in the middle. I have added a big rock to the end of the holes although I know that it is not supposed to be there (it is a MOC!). Most of the details were done on the holes where I used a lot of small pieces. In this scene, Ki Adi Mundi leads a group of clones (made by me) over the rock and they have captured an anti-aircraft turret and are pushing on. There is a downed AT-AP on the rock and an E-Web blaster (my design) on the ground with and AT-RT running through the remaining droids. Note that there is a rocket in the middle of the battle because a Heavy Trooper (clone trooper with rocket launcher) hiding behind the AT-AP (well, sort of) has just fired a shot.
